Thankfully, there are ways to take care of these issues.

Woman’s legs after bathing

Healthline advises that rather than rub yourself dry with a towel after your shower, you should lightly pat.

You might also want to takecooler showersand not use so much steaming hot water.

Finally, moisturize your skin while it’s still wet.

Diluted essential oils can also be added to your shower routine.

The one thing you shouldn’t do, though, is use a corticosteroid over-the-counter medication for after-shower itching.
